Description
Entanglements – Writing the Environment is a 4-day course which offers participants the opportunity to develop their writing skills and interests in ways that promote and illustrate environmental awareness, concerns, and sensitivities. Participants will explore diverse issues of the environment captured in writing through experimenting with a variety of writing forms from the glossary definition, annotations, essay, review, poetry, short fiction and novel. The course format will include examination of literary texts related to environmental themes, class discussions, as well as writing and editing practice to texts produced throughout the course. By the end of this course, participants will have a new literary appreciation and increased confidence in writing about the natural world.
What You Will Learn
1. To understand different formats of writing and writing conventions that can be applied to other facets of daily life.
2. To integrate environmental concerns in writing of fiction and non-fiction.
3. To identify and analyse developments in the field of environmental literature through the study of specific works.
4. To develop a personal style of writing by connecting ideas and creating an effective narrative.
Who Should Sign Up
Artists, Cultural Producers, Curators, Researchers, Educators, Naturalists, Editors, Art Critics, Budding Writers or someone who simply enjoys writing
Course Instructors
Jason Wee and Anca Rujoiu
